As an MRI Lead Radiographer at our Woking Hospital, you'll bring a BSC degree in diagnostic radiography (or equivalent) and a postgraduate qualification. Ideally, you've also had Radiation Protection Supervisor training. But what's vital is your caring nature. Seeing patients as people, you offer understanding and empathy.

As an MRI Lead Radiographer, you will:

* Act as the clinical lead for MRI services across the department, wards and theatre settings.

* Deliver a high-quality diagnostic imaging service for a diverse caseload. * Work alongside leading practitioners using advanced imaging techniques, equipment and facilities.

* Lead the development, review and implementation of policies, procedures and best practice.

* Supervise, support and develop junior colleagues and wider team members.

* Ensure the highest standards of patient care are delivered with sensitivity, compassion and professionalism.

* Operate Siemens MRI scanners and perform a broad range of MRI examinations, including cardiac MRI, drawing on a minimum of three years' relevant experience.

* Maintain strict patient and staff safety standards within the MRI environment.

* Demonstrate excellent communication, collaboration and teamworking skills.

* Take a proactive, innovative and forward-thinking approach to service delivery and continuous improvement.

The successful candidate will be qualified Radiographer and registered with the HCPC. you will have experience in managing a team of Radiographers or existing MR lead within the NHS or Private Health care service in the UK. You will be able to demonstrate your ability to take accountability and ownership of developing a department and managing a team. The successful applicant will lead on clinical aspects of training and competencies, QA, MRI safety investigations and ensure that the MRI team are up to date with current practice.

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
